What Is the Job of a Consumer Insight Analyst?

A consumer insight analyst helps a business understand their consumers or clients. Your responsibilities in this career are to perform research and collect data regarding sales trends and consumer satisfaction. You then analyze the information to identify issues or shortcomings. Your duties may be to design potential processes and procedures or merely provide reports to assist in product development, marketing strategies, sales projections, or improvement of the services of the company. You might also utilize your research to determine areas that are not currently being met by sales markets. As a customer insight analyst, you may work independently or operate as a part of a team.

How Can I Become a Consumer Insight Analyst?

The basic academic qualifications needed to become a consumer insight analyst include a bachelor’s degree in marketing or a similar area of study. You may also need some experience working in marketing, business management, and retail or customer analytics before starting work as an analyst. You need to have excellent communication skills and exceptional analytical abilities. It is helpful to have an aptitude for mathematics for calculating statistical data on demand trends. Basic computer skills are also required.

What type of data do Consumer Insight Analysts work with?

Consumer Insight Analysts work with a wide range of data sources, including market research surveys, social media data, sales data, website analytics, and customer feedback. They gather and analyze qualitative and quantitative data to gain a comprehensive understanding of consumer trends, preferences, and behaviors.

How do Consumer Insight Analysts provide value to businesses?

By analyzing consumer data, Consumer Insight Analysts provide crucial insights and recommendations to businesses. They uncover consumer preferences and behavior patterns, identify emerging market trends, and help businesses understand their target audience better. This insight is used to tailor marketing strategies, improve product offerings, and enhance the overall customer experience.

What tools and software do Consumer Insight Analysts use?

Consumer Insight Analysts work with a variety of tools and software. They often utilize data analytics software such as SPSS, SAS, or R for statistical analysis. Additionally, they may use visualization tools like Tableau or Power BI to present data in a visually appealing and easy-to-understand manner.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int is also essential for data manipulation and preparing reports and presentations.

Job Summary

Job Summary: The Consumer Insight Analyst is responsible for gathering, analyzing, and interpreting consumer data to provide valuable insights and recommendations that enhance business decision-making processes. In this role, you will coll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ify consumer behavior, trends, and preferences, helping the organization align its strategies with customer needs and preferences.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Collect, analyze, and interpret consumer data from various sources such as surveys, interviews, focus groups, and social media platforms.
  • Identify patterns, trends, and correlations in consumer behavior to help drive strategic decision-making.
  • Collaborate with marketing, product development, and sales teams to provide data-driven insights that support the development of effective marketing and sales strategies.
  • Conduct thorough market research to identify market opportunities, competitive trends, and potential customer segments.
  • Generate reports, presentations, and dashboards to effectively communicate key findings and recommendations to stakeholders at various levels of the organization.
  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ends, competitors, and emerging technologies to suggest innovative approaches to consumer insights.
  • Develop and maintain a comprehensive knowledge of the organization's products and services to accurately analyze consumer feedback and preferences.
  • Assist in the development and implementation of consumer surveys and other data collection methods to gather actionable insights.
  • Continuously monitor, track, and evaluate marketing and sales campaigns to measure their impact on consumer behavior and make data-driven recommendations for improvement.
  • Collaborate with data scientists and data analysts to leverage advanced analytics tools and techniques to gain deeper insights from consumer data.

Requirements and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in business, marketing, statistics, or a related field.
  • Proven experience in consumer insights, market research, or related roles.
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ret complex data sets and draw actionable insights.
  • Proficient in statistical analysis methodologies, data modeling, and visualization tools.
  •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to translate complex data into clear and impactful recommendations.
  • Keen attention to detail and a strong commitment to accuracy in data analysis.
  • Proficient in using data analysis software such as SPSS, SAS, or R.
  • Familiarity with CRM systems, customer segmentation, and data management principles.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
  • Proactive attitude with a passion for understanding consumer behavior and trends.
